#Revit #плагины #автоматизация #спецификация
## Описание
Кнопка на панели:
![[Плагин Импорт CSV 1.png]]
Импорт CSV файла в спецификацию на активном виде.
При импорте производится изменение значений параметров элементов в спецификации в соответствии со значениями в импортируемом файле.
## Требования для работы
Наличие активного вида спецификации при запуске плагина.
Количество столбцов и строк спецификации и таблицы в CSV файле должно совпадать.
> [!hint]
> Для исключения ошибок, рекомендуется использовать плагин следующим образом:
> - открыть спецификацию, в которой нужно задать значения параметров элементов
> - экспортировать спецификацию с помощью [[Плагин Экспорт CSV]]
> - изменить значения в файле CSV с помощью редактора электронных таблиц или текстового редактора
> - сохранить изменения в файле и импортировать его
## Использование
1. Открыть спецификацию;
2. Запустить плагин;
3. Выбрать файл таблицы CSV;
Особенности импорта:
- если при импорте некоторые параметры не были изменены, то откроется информационное окно с таблицей. Ячейки, которые не удалось изменить, помечены красным цветом. При наведении на них курсора мыши можно посмотреть имя объекта и причину ошибки.
- при импорте сгруппированной спецификации изменение в ячейке применяется для всех элементов, которые были сгруппированы.
- пустая ячейка в CSV файле обозначает пустое значение, а не то, что в данной ячейке присутствуют различные значения. То есть при импорте значений в сгруппированную спецификацию пустое значение будет проставлено для всех сгруппированных элементов в данной ячейке.
> [!warning]
> Не поддерживается импорт спецификации, если она была отсортирована по расчетному или объединенному полю.
Не поддерживается изменение расчетных или объединенных полей.